Background
-
Background: Oral-facial-digital syndrome 1 protein is a protein that in humans is encoded by the OFD1 gene. This gene is mapped to Xp22.2. This gene is located on the X chromosome and encodes a centrosomal protein. A knockout mouse model has been used to study the effect of mutations in this gene. The mouse gene is also located on the X chromosome, however, unlike the human gene it is not subject to X inactivation. Mutations in this gene are associated with oral-facial-digital syndrome type I and Simpson-Golabi-Behmel syndrome type 2. Many pseudogenes have been identified, a single pseudogene is found on chromosome 5 while as many as fifteen have been found on the Y chromosome.
Gene Full Name: OFD1 centriole and centriolar satellite protein
